ADMINISTRATION > Accounting Department
The Accounting Department is responsible for the collection of
data concerning financial resources, obligations and net resources
of the County. The data will provide a new source of information
for the County Commissioners and assures property custodianship of
the resources. The department also maintains and prepares records
for the annual audit.

The Human Resource Coordaintor is responsible for employee payroll,
employee benefits and maintaining all personnel files.
2006 Accomplishments
- Continued to host trainings with department heads and supervisors in the areas of workers compensation, FMLA, ADA, etc.
- Continued to host meetings with employees to educate them on benefits that are offered and explain their own selection of benefits.
- Continued to update all personnel files.
- Continued to upgrade job descriptions for all personnel.
- Web site has allowed an alternative method for job applications.
- Accomplished all ACS software updates.
- Implemented GASB 34 financial reporting for year end 12/31/05
2007 Goals
- To continue training with elected officials, department heads, and supervisors on workers compensation, FMLA, ADA, new fair labor standards laws.
- To continue to host meetings to inform employees of benefits that are offered by the County and to explain their own benefit selections.
- Begin the process of creating forms and a procedural manual specific to the accounting department.
- Complete the revision of the Alamosa County Policy and Benefit handbook.
- To continue updating county infrastructure records for early implementation of GASB 34 infrastructure reporting.
- Continue to maintain and update new web page including job announcements.
- Implement intra county web system for all employees.
- Implement pay plan.
